Identifying Subtle Verbal Abuse HelpcardBy Robert Bacal - Verbal abuse -- most of us know the obvious "in your face" kinds of verbal abuse like yelling, sweating or outright insults. There's another kind of verbal abuse; the kind that's less obvious, and occurs on almost a daily basis. SUBTLE VERBAL ABUSE is abuse that is under the surface, and it's no less damaging to you and your relationships than the more obvious types.
